Q: How is Firecrete Super Refractory Castable applied in industrial settings?
A: Firecrete Super Refractory Castable is typically mixed with water to create a workable slurry, which is then poured or packed into molds or directly on surfaces requiring high-temperature resistance. It is commonly used for lining kilns, furnaces, and reactors in industries like cement, ceramic, and petrochemicals. Once set and cured, it forms a high-strength, heat-resistant layer.
